E14
Belling
User Interface / Control Panel Communication Fault
Washer-dryer displays E14; may not respond to program selection or buttons.

Possible Causes
Loose UI harness connector, Faulty control panel PCB, Moisture ingress into control fascia, Main PCB communication failure
How to Fix / Troubleshooting
Safety: Disconnect mains power before removing the control panel or top cover.
- Power reset: Unplug the Belling washer-dryer for 10 minutes to allow capacitors to discharge, then reconnect and test. This can clear minor communication glitches.
- Inspect control fascia: Check for signs of moisture or detergent ingress around the buttons and display. Dry the area gently and avoid spraying cleaners directly onto the panel.
- Check UI harness: Remove the top cover and locate the ribbon cable or harness between the user interface board and the main PCB. Reseat both ends carefully, ensuring no bent pins.
- Visual PCB check: Inspect both the UI board and main PCB for burnt components, corrosion, or cracked solder joints. Any visible damage usually requires board replacement.
- Replacement: If reseating connectors does not resolve E14, either the UI board or main PCB is likely faulty. Replacement should follow Belling part numbers and may require programming; use a qualified technician.
